NEW DELHI: The citizens of the national capital are among the most prosperous people the country. A study on the 'Assets and liabilities of household sector in Delhi' shows that Delhiites were way ahead of everybody in the nation in terms of are being the most affluent. Delhi ranked third in the country with respect to average value of assets per households in urban area after Jammu and Kashmir and Kerala. According to the findings, an average value of assets per family in the capital was 2.4 times higher than the national average and the debt per family six times lower than the country's benchmark. The average value of assets owned per family in Delhi was estimated at Rs 7.42 lakh, while the average value of assets per person worked out to Rs 1.62 lakh. Prepared by the Directorate of Economics and Statistics on the basis of a sample survey, the report further said that of the total assets, land accounted for 59 percent and buildings 29 percent. Delhi also showed itself in a comfort zone in terms of average amount of debt. The city accounted for an average amount of loans per family at only Rs 1366 as against the all India average of Rs 8694. The average amount of debt per household was the highest in the self-employed category.
